Missing Language choices from Settings page after update
Posted: Sat Mar 30, 2013 1:25 am
Script URL: helpdesk.johnsonlumber.biz
Version of script: 2.4.2
Hosting company: Internal
URL of phpinfo.php:
URL of session_test.php:
What terms did you try when SEARCHING for a solution:
blank language selection, error missing hesklang, text.php wrong version not 2.4.2
Write your message below:
Just updated from 2.2 to 2.4.2. I accidentally deleted the hesk_settings.inc.php file before updating. I ended up running through the upgrade process using the generic settings php file tweaked with my DB info. everything looks good, i still see the tickets from 2.2 but in the Settings screen the Default Language dropdown has no values available. If I click the Test language folder link I get a pop up with an error message:
/language
|-> /en
|-> text.php: ERROR
|----> MISSING: $hesklang['LANGUAGE']
|----> MISSING: $hesklang['ENCODING']
|----> MISSING: $hesklang['_COLLATE']
|----> MISSING: $hesklang['EMAIL_HR']
|----> WRONG VERSION (not 2.4.2)
|-> /emails: OK
I tried copying over the language folder from the 2.4.2 zip file but it didn't help. I ended up deleting the entire directory and rerunning the install script but I get the same error. Searching brings up a ton of posts but none relate to this. I cant use the Settings page to change anything because as soon as I click Save changes it gives me a red error at the top telling me I need to choose a default language (which I can't)
Version of script: 2.4.2
Hosting company: Internal
URL of phpinfo.php:
URL of session_test.php:
What terms did you try when SEARCHING for a solution:
blank language selection, error missing hesklang, text.php wrong version not 2.4.2
Write your message below:
Just updated from 2.2 to 2.4.2. I accidentally deleted the hesk_settings.inc.php file before updating. I ended up running through the upgrade process using the generic settings php file tweaked with my DB info. everything looks good, i still see the tickets from 2.2 but in the Settings screen the Default Language dropdown has no values available. If I click the Test language folder link I get a pop up with an error message:
/language
|-> /en
|-> text.php: ERROR
|----> MISSING: $hesklang['LANGUAGE']
|----> MISSING: $hesklang['ENCODING']
|----> MISSING: $hesklang['_COLLATE']
|----> MISSING: $hesklang['EMAIL_HR']
|----> WRONG VERSION (not 2.4.2)
|-> /emails: OK
I tried copying over the language folder from the 2.4.2 zip file but it didn't help. I ended up deleting the entire directory and rerunning the install script but I get the same error. Searching brings up a ton of posts but none relate to this. I cant use the Settings page to change anything because as soon as I click Save changes it gives me a red error at the top telling me I need to choose a default language (which I can't)